[Eduonix] GIT for beginners
- Stipulations should not obtainable for this course.
Are you front-end developer or back-end, in gaming or fintech growth – does not matter. Model management system – is what unites us all. We work in groups and must coordinate our work and code to ship a high-quality answer.
Git is the perfect instrument to manage your code. Study ideas of Git to simplify your work!
Course Introduction offers an introduction to this course and the Git supply management system and units the stage for the remainder of the course.
After the introduction, the very first thing we do is Git Set up for each Linux and Mac.
Fast Begin a really fast, hands-on Introduction to Git. We begin off by signing up for GitHub, making a repository there, the makiing an area copy (clone), native modifications (add/commit) after which replace GitHub with our modifications (push). Additionaly, will generate SSH key and add it to GitHub account.
In Primary Instructions, we stroll via all of the foundational instructions wanted to begin a brand new mission managed by Git (or allow Git for an current mission) throughout making commits, together with frequent file operations like transferring and deleting recordsdata. We additionally cowl find out how to exclude the unsuitable recordsdata from by chance being dedicated and find out how to assessment your repository’s historical past
With a powerful basis in place, we discover methods to make Comparisons in Git, together with all of the totally different native states, between commits, and between native and distant repositories.
We give nice attending to Branching and Merging in Git. We begin off with the straightforward “completely happy path” and study “Quick-Ahead” merges and find out how to management them. The we stroll via frequent “computerized” merges. Lastly, we trigger bother on goal so we will step via resolving conflicting merges with our visible merge instrument.
With a powerful basis in branching and merging, we are going to then cowl a extra advanced matter, Rebasing. In that part, we cowl a number of rebasing examples, together with find out how to resolve a rebase battle.
Within the Superior part, we save our work-in-progress whereas we attend to extra urgent points, then choose up the place we left off after that. We’ll cowl git tags and stashing native modifications. One of the vital vital half right here is branching methods. How can we use Git.